Douze Hypergraphies Polylogue, a 1964 limited‑edition softcover by Isidore Isou and Michel Tapie, 54 pages, in French, published by International Center of Aesthetic Research Torino, is a numbered original with autographs by Isou and Tapié at the colophon and a dedication from Tapie, in good condition.
